I am sorry to see Volponi leave the States. I don't know how his numbers were for mares bred in 2005, but he covered 80 in 2004.

Any thoughts on his departure?

I'm sorry to see him go, too. He was a game little horse. As long as they take good care of him, he's probably better off there. He'll be a big star in Korea. They're really trying to improve their stud book. Here, he didn't get a lot of respect. Hopefully, he'll do well as a sire there and perhaps come back to the States as a pensioner.

I do remember hearing that his numbers were quite low in 2005 (around 24 or so? it would require further investigation). Physically, I heard a lot of complaints about him on this board, people were going to evaluate him and coming away shaking their heads. I suppose it was the memory of his Breeder's Cup that got him a decent book the first year, and by the second there were "new and improved" Breeder's Cup heroes to visit.

I enjoyed watching him in his racing days and I hope that the Koreans appreciate him more than we Americans did.
